V. Services offered on the website

  1. The User upon being successfully registered with Enalo will be provided access to a dashboard (linked to the User Account) which shall contain details of all transactions undertaken by the User through the Website.
  2. Enalo, as part of the Services, offers an array of services on the Website to the User vis-à-vis the User Account, as enumerated in detail below.
  3. Collection Services
    1. As part of the Services, the User whilst availing of our collection services, can generate an unlimited number of invoices, and send these invoices to its Customers. Under this Service, Enalo also keeps a track of all the payments pending to be received by the User and sends automated payment reminders to the Customers. This Service shall hereinafter be referred to as the “Collection Service/s”.
    2. The Collection Service helps the User in ensuring that no invoice or details of any of its Customers are misplaced.
    3. Once payments are received by Enalo from the relevant Customer, as part of the Collection Services, Enalo deposits such payments into the User Bank Account within a period 3 (Three) working days of receipt of payment or such other period as determined by Enalo on case to case basis.
    4. Enalo undertakes to notify the User on a day to day basis of all transactions undertaken by Enalo pursuant to the provision of these Collection Services. It shall be the sole responsibility of the User to regularly check its User Account for any such notifications.
    5. The User acknowledges and understands that through the Collection Services provided on the Website, Enalo is merely providing a medium to generate invoices and facilitate payments, as and when received, to the User in accordance with these Terms. The User further acknowledges and understands that Enalo shall not be liable or responsible for any actions or inactions of the Customers and hereby disclaims any and all responsibility and liability in that regard. Enalo shall further not be required to mediate or resolve any dispute or disagreement that may arise between the User and its Customer.
    6. Enalo offers no guarantee or warranty that pursuant to the Collection Services, there would be a satisfactory/prompt response or any response at all from the Customer or that the payments corresponding to the invoices will be received by the User on time.
  4. Payment Services
    1. As part of the Services, the User whilst availing of our payment services, can receive an unlimited number of invoices from its Vendors and store details of the same in the User Account. Under this Service, Enalo also facilitates payments to be made by the User to its Vendors. This Service shall hereinafter be referred to as the “Payment Service/s”.
    2. The Payment Service offers a convenient and secure way to make payments towards the User’s Vendors using the User Bank Account. The User acknowledges and understands that once a payment is made to the Vendor in accordance with these Terms, the User shall not be entitled to stop or seek a reversal of the payment made to the relevant Vendor.
    3. The User acknowledges and understands that through the Payment Services provided on the Website, Enalo is merely providing a medium to facilitate payments to the Vendors in accordance with these Terms. The User further acknowledges and understands that Enalo shall not be liable or responsible for any actions or inactions of the Vendors and hereby disclaims any and all responsibility and liability in that regard. Enalo shall further not be required to mediate or resolve any dispute or disagreement that may arise between the User and its Vendor.
    4. The User acknowledges and understands that Enalo shall not be liable or responsible if it is unable to affect any payments due to any one or more of the following circumstances:
      • (a)  If the payment instruction(s) or the Vendor details issued by the User is/are incomplete, inaccurate, invalid and delayed;
      • (b)  If the User Bank Account has insufficient funds/credit limits to cover for the amount as mentioned in the payment instruction(s);
      • (c)  If the funds available in the User Bank Account are under any encumbrance or charge;
      • (d)  If the payment made to the Vendor is not processed by such Vendor upon receipt;
      • (e)  If the payment cannot be made due to occurrence of a Force Majeure Event.
      • (f)   In case the bill payment is not effected for any reason, You will be intimated about the failed payment by an e-mail.
    5. Enalo undertakes to notify the User on a day to day basis of all transactions undertaken by Enalo pursuant to the provision of these Payment Services. It shall be the sole responsibility of the User to regularly check its User Account for any such notifications.
  5. Banking Services
    1. As part of the Services, the User whilst availing of our banking services, can open a non-interest bearing current account with the Partner Banks (“User Current Account”) without any logistical hassles/delay (such Service hereinafter referred to as the “Banking Services”). The User shall be required to submit duly filled application form/s along with the prescribed set of documents stipulated from time to time, to the satisfaction of the Partner Bank.
    2. The User acknowledges and understands that through the Banking Services provided on the Website, Enalo is merely facilitating the quick and hassle-free opening of the User Current Account with the Partner Bank and shall, therefore, not be liable or responsible for any actions or inactions of the Partner Bank in relation to the User Current Account and hereby disclaims any and all responsibility and liability in that regard. Enalo shall further not be required to mediate or resolve any dispute or disagreement that may arise between the User and its Customer.
